Transaction 870b60996f558941a76246b17ca3fddaeb37970c1d3a4715c2effff574f79ba9
1 Input
1 Output
-
870b60996f558941a76246b17ca3fddaeb37970c1d3a4715c2effff574f79ba9:0
- value
- 61005050
- script pubkey
- OP_0 OP_PUSHBYTES_20 4e1c7e5a46a79ebcf64baf82ec0f1589c310575d
- address
- bc1qfcw8ukjx570teajt47pwcrc438p3q46a877my6